Born in Sapporo, Hokkaido. Graduated from Musashino Art University and completed graduate studies at Tokyo University of the Arts. In 2010, she began her career after hearing a comment from her university teacher. In 2012, she made her debut with her first album, 'Shibata Satoko Island, ' produced by Hiroki Misawa and featuring multiple tracks. Since then, she has expanded her activities to include singing, such as the hour-long monologue-like work 'Tanomosi Musume' at the theater festival Festival/Tokyo 13, and has released eight albums to date. In 2016, she published her first poetry collection, 'Desert. ' In the same year, she won the 5th El Sur Foundation Newcomer Award in the Contemporary Poetry category. She has also contributed many essays, poems, and picture book stories. In 2023, she published a collection of essays, 'Kiregire no Diary, ' a compilation of her serialization in the literary magazine 'Bungakukai' over a period of seven years. In 2024, she joined the 'Shizuoka Renshi no Kai. ' She is also attracting attention as a poet and writer. On February 28, 2024, she will release the album 'Your Favorite Things, ' followed by 'My Favorite Things' on October 23. Her second collection of poems, 'Dive in Theater, ' is scheduled to be published on December 26. She has also appeared in numerous guest performances and written songs, and her creativity knows no bounds.
